Belaruskaia Vyvedka: Citizens Will Be Banned From Leaving Belarus Within Six Months

A "permit" system will be introduced, as in the USSR.

Lukashenka listened to the results of the work of the "Special Group" before the Supreme People's Assembly, which was engaged in curbing migration from Belarus, the Belaruskaia Vyvedka. (“Belarusian Intelligence”) Telegram channel writes.

Their sources report that the conversation was nerve-wracking. Tertel reported that all instructions to limit the possibilities of obtaining Schengen visas for citizens were fulfilled promptly, and those leaving were put under control, crossing the border was as difficult as possible.

The Security Council, in turn, presented an analyst on the leakage of personnel, specialists in popular specialties and applicants/students. All previous measures (Psychological operations, hybrid attacks of migrants, provoking the closure of checkpoints, etc.) are recognized as successful but insufficient.

The leak continues unabated. Moreover, the "political" emigration was replaced by "economic" emigration. According to statistics, the main flow of people leaving the country is people under 40 (young people, families with children). Propaganda measures to call for return and the commission did not yield any results.

As a result, it was decided to increase pressure in all areas identified by the "special group" and move on to the tactics of even greater difficulty in obtaining visas and the process of crossing the border. It was decided to smoothly reduce the number of international buses within six months and further slow down the border crossing, making it undesirable.

Measures will be gradually introduced to restrict the departure of young specialists: university graduates and students of military age (it will be necessary to obtain the approval of the military registration and enlistment office).

Lukashenka demanded to act hybrid, without causing total discontent among citizens, but to do much more than has been achieved so far.

Our sources claim that all brutal measures (restrictions for conscripts, students, etc.) will not be introduced before the "elections". However, during this period, the "house" will adopt a number of laws that allow restricting the movement of citizens across the border for wider categories and a wider list of reasons.

In other words, before the "elections", they will slow down the border even more, make visas more difficult and curb the flow of migration of citizens and capital step by step. Immediately after the elections, several legislative acts should be put into effect, allowing, if necessary, to return to the total Soviet practices of the "permit" system for leaving the country, which will practically make leaving for the EU and other countries possible only with the permission of the Lukashenka regime.

“If you have plans to move to another country, then you have time left until February-March 2025,” sums up Belaruskaya Vysvedka.
